SASM is a free and open source assembly IDE and debugger for x86 and x64 architectures. It provides a simple interface for writing, building, debugging and analyzing assembly code.

TypeScript is a typed superset of JavaScript developed by Microsoft that adds optional static typing, classes, interfaces and other features to JavaScript. It is designed for development of large applications and compiles to plain JavaScript.
